As a partner of the Global Outbreak Alert and Response Network (GOARN), the Australasian College for Infection Prevention and Control (ACIPC) receives requests for assistance on a regular basis. This session will explain the role of the GOARN Focal Point in ACIPC and the process for responding to these requests. This session will also provide participants with insight into current partnership activities between GOARN and ACIPC.


Biography: Dr Peta-Anne Zimmerman is an internationally respected clinician, educator and researcher in infection prevention and control. Dr Zimmerman’s experience includes consultancy work with the World Health Organization (WHO), AusAID, the Asian Development Bank (ADB), and the Secretariat of the Pacific Communities (SPC). Peta-Anne is a Visiting Research Fellow with the Gold Coast Hospital and Health Service Infection Control Department and Senior Lecturer of the Griffith Graduate Infection Prevention and Control Program. She is also a Board Director of the Australasian College for Infection Prevention and Control.
